OVERSEAS MAILS.
INCOMING.
The Marama is due at Auckland at 10 a.m to-day. She has 56 bags of Australian mail from Sydney for this port.
A steamer left Sydney for Wellington on Saturday with 15 bags of Australian mail for Auckland. The Maunganui is duo at Wellington from San Francisco on December 22 with a large Quantity of English and American mail for New Zealand. The Moeraki arrived at Wellington from Melbourne yesterday afternoon with mail .from Australia and beyond for Auckland. The letter portion, 22 bags, will reach here by train to-morrow morning, and 162 bags of newspapers, etc., by goods train tomorrow evening
OUTGOING. Outgoing mails for overseas ports close at Auckland as under: — To-day. Australian States, Ceylon, India, China, Japin, Straits Settlements, South Africa and Egypt, per Niagara, at 7 p.m. December 23. Fiji, Japan, Honolulu, Canada, North America, West Indies, United Kingdom and Continent of Europe, per Niagara, at 10 a.m. Mails duo at London about January 24. W. J. COW, Chief Postmaster.
